损失率、贫化率对某露天铀矿战略排产技术经济指标影响研究

摘    要:某露天铀矿项目自生产以来,实际损失率和贫化率大于可行性研究阶段取值,影响项目战略排产。根据历史生产数据,制定分别以26%贫化率和8%损失率为基准的十一种损失率、贫化率影响分析测算方案,运用Whittle软件,选用Psedoflow算法和Milawa NPV算法对十一种方案进行境界优化和战略排产,分析损失率、贫化率对净现值、生产成本、服务年限、剥采比等技术经济指标影响。结果表明:贫化率对废石量、净现值、水冶成本等指标影响较大,结合目前生产实际贫化率与行业标准的差距较大,开采过程中加强贫化控制,将提升生产效益;1号采坑北部区域境界、水冶成本、采出矿石量等指标受贫化率影响最为明显,设计中单独作为一个分期,最后进行开采,并需进行补充地质勘探;损失率对回收金属量、采出矿石量和净现值影响较大,但生产实际损失率与行业标准差异较小,总体对生产影响一般。

Study on the influence of ore loss rate and dilution rate on the technical and economic indexes of strategic planning of an open-pit uranium mine

Abstract:Since the production of an open-pit uranium mine, the actual ore loss rate and ore dilution rate are higher than the values taken in the feasibility study stage, which affect the strategic planning of the project. Based on the historical production data, when analyzing the influence of the ore loss, set the ore dilution to 26%, and when analyzing the influence of the ore dilution, set the ore loss to 8%. In this study, the Psedoflow algorithm and the Milawa NPV algorithm in Whittle software are used to do pit optimization and strategic planning for eleven ore loss and dilution schemes, and use output data to analyze the impact of ore loss rate and dilution rate on technical and economic indicators such as NPV, production cost, mine life, stripping ratio and so on.. The results show that the ore dilution has a great impact on the mined waste rock tons, NPV and unit process cost, considering the large gap between the actual ore dilution and the industry standard, strengthening the dilution control during the mining will improve production efficiency. The northern area of Pit 1 is greatly affected by the ore dilution, such as pit shell, process cost and mined ore tons, it shall be designed as a separate stage which mined last, and supplementary geological exploration is required. The ore loss has a greater impact on total metal quantity, mined ore tons and NPV, the difference between the actual ore loss and the industry standard is small, and the overall impact on production is general.
